351. He Leadeth Me

1 He leadeth me! O blessed thought!
O words with heav'nly comfort fraught!
Whate'er I do where'er I be,
Still 'tis God's hand that leadeth me!

Chours:
He leadeth me, He leadeth me,
By His own hand He leadeth me:
His faithful foll'wer I would be,
For by His hand He leadeth me.

2 Sometimes 'mid scenes of deepest gloom,
Sometimes where Eden's bowers bloom,
By waters still, o'er troubled sea,
Still 'tis His hand that leadeth me! [Chorus]

3 Lord, I would clasp Thy hand in mine,
Nor ever murmur nor repine,
Content, whatever lot I see,
Since 'tis my God that leadeth me! [Chorus]

4 And when my task on earth is done,
When, by Thy grace the vict'ry's won,
E'en death's cold wave I will not flee,
Since God through Jordan leadeth me. [Chorus]

Text Information
First Line: He leadeth me! O blessed thought!
Title: He Leadeth Me
Author: Joseph H. Gilmore, 1834-1918
Refrain First Line: He leadeth me, He leadeth me
Language: English
Publication Date: 1970
Topic: Guidance and Care; Praise and Testimony
Tune Information
Name: [He leadeth me! O blessed thought!]
Composer: William B. Bradbury, 1816-1868
Key: Dâ™­ Major
